Is Fortaleza Safe for Solo Female Travelers?

As a solo female traveler in Fortaleza, exercise caution due to cases of street crime such as handbag snatching. Various neighborhoods are also advised to be avoided after dark. Taxis are recommended over public transport, especially at night. Use a reputable taxi company or Uber. Be vigilant on the beach and when carrying valuables around the city. Despite the concerns, many travelers have peaceful stays when precautions are taken.

How safe is Fortaleza?

Safety at night:

Safety at night:Unsafe

Like many large cities, Fortaleza has areas that are more secure than others. However, walking alone at night in Fortaleza is generally not recommended as the city suffers from high levels of petty and violent crime. Stay in well-lit areas, avoid empty streets, and always take a licensed taxi or use a trusted ride-sharing app if you need to travel at night.
Public transportation:

Public transportation:Moderate

Public transportation in Fortaleza can be quite unpredictable. Though buses are frequently used by locals and tourists alike, instances of petty crime such as pickpocketing or robberies are not uncommon, particularly in crowded areas. It is advisable not to flaunt valuable items and always stay aware of your surroundings. However, most journeys go without issue and this shouldn't discourage usage.
Street harassment:

Street harassment:High

Fortaleza is known for its vibrant culture and beautiful beaches, but it is also a city where women may experience a higher level of street harassment compared to some other destinations. Catcalling, unwanted comments, and even minor physical contact like touching or grabbing, are unfortunately not uncommon in crowded places, especially at night. Despite these factors, many female travelers still enjoy the city's many attractions safely. It's important to always remain aware of your surroundings, avoid walking alone at night whenever possible, and remember that any form of harassment is not a reflection on you, but rather on those perpetrating it.
Petty crimes:

Petty crimes:High

While Fortaleza is a vibrant city renowned for its beautiful beaches, it does unfortunately see a higher measure of petty crime compared to some other parts of Brazil. Theft and pickpocketing are the most common issues, especially in crowded areas and on public transportation. Always stay alert and keep your personal belongings close and secure to minimize the risk.
